What is Cursor?

Cursor is an AI-native code editor designed to deeply integrate AI into software development workflows.

Built on a VS Code-compatible foundation, Cursor combines:

  • AI code completion
  • Natural language editing
  • Multi-file generation
  • Repository understanding
  • Chat-based development
  • Refactoring assistance
  • AI debugging workflows

Cursor became popular because it made AI feel embedded directly into coding rather than bolted on through external plugins.

Instead of constantly switching between editor and chatbot, developers interact with AI directly inside their coding workflow.

What is Windsurf?

Windsurf is an AI-native development environment focused heavily on agentic software engineering workflows.

Its biggest differentiator is:

Autonomous multi-step AI task execution.

Windsurf emphasizes AI systems that can:

  • Plan tasks
  • Modify multiple files
  • Execute commands
  • Debug issues
  • Iterate automatically
  • Understand repositories semantically

The platform positions itself more aggressively around AI agents rather than simple autocomplete.

Agentic Workflows

Agentic coding is one of the biggest trends in AI development tools.

This is where Windsurf differentiates itself most aggressively.


Windsurf Cascade Workflows

Windsurf’s Cascade system enables developers to:

  • Describe tasks naturally
  • Delegate engineering work
  • Execute multi-file modifications
  • Run commands
  • Validate outputs
  • Iterate automatically

Example:

"Add role-based authentication across the dashboard and admin routes."

The AI may:

  • Create middleware
  • Update routes
  • Modify APIs
  • Adjust frontend logic
  • Run builds
  • Fix errors

This workflow feels closer to delegating work to an engineering assistant.


Cursor Agent Workflows

Cursor also supports:

  • Multi-file edits
  • Repository-wide refactors
  • AI chat workflows
  • Code generation
  • Refactoring assistance

However, Cursor still feels more editor-centric than fully agent-centric.

Winner: Windsurf

Windsurf currently pushes further into autonomous AI engineering workflows.

Final Verdict

Both Cursor and Windsurf are among the most powerful AI-native development tools available in 2026, but they optimize for different developer workflows.

Choose Cursor if you want:

  • Best-in-class inline completion
  • Familiar developer workflows
  • Smooth VS Code migration
  • Fast productivity improvements
  • AI-enhanced editing

Choose Windsurf if you need:

  • Agentic AI workflows
  • Autonomous task execution
  • Multi-step engineering delegation
  • AI-driven automation systems
  • Large-scale multi-file orchestration

For many developers, Cursor currently provides the smoother day-to-day editing experience.

But Windsurf represents one of the strongest pushes toward truly agentic software engineering workflows.

Ultimately, the best AI editor depends on whether you want:

  • An intelligent coding assistant or
  • A semi-autonomous AI engineering collaborator

The only reliable way to decide is to test both tools directly against your real codebase, workflows, and development style.
